Product Details
The Broadcom thin film pyroelectric infrared flame detectors/IR sensors an analog single is current mode sensor that has excellent signal to noise at the signature 8-10 Hz flicker range of a flame and can provide accurate discrimination of flame sources in triple IR flame detection systems. The sensor element is built into a low noise circuit that has an internal CMOS op amp with a 10GΩ feedback resistor outputting a voltage signal centered on half the supply rail.
